]> git.sesse.net Git - cubemap/blobdiff - log.cpp
Identify UDPInput error messages by the stream, too.
[cubemap] / log.cpp
diff --git a/log.cpp b/log.cpp
index a4f923644a5b9597febecb038fa8c54c8526a207..39ad9eb627056ea539f4d216c26c8359eced5d10 100644 (file)
--- a/log.cpp
+++ b/log.cpp
@@ -76,7 +76,7 @@ void log(LogLevel log_level, const char *fmt, ...)
                syslog_level = LOG_INFO;
                break;
        case INFO:
-               log_level_str = "INFO: ";
+               log_level_str = "INFO:    ";
                syslog_level = LOG_INFO;
                break;
        case WARNING:
@@ -84,7 +84,7 @@ void log(LogLevel log_level, const char *fmt, ...)
                syslog_level = LOG_WARNING;
                break;
        case ERROR:
-               log_level_str = "ERROR: ";
+               log_level_str = "ERROR:   ";
                syslog_level = LOG_ERR;
                break;
        default:
@@ -116,6 +116,5 @@ void log(LogLevel log_level, const char *fmt, ...)
 void log_perror(const char *msg)
 {
        char errbuf[4096];
-       strerror_r(errno, errbuf, sizeof(errbuf));
-       log(ERROR, "%s: %s", msg, errbuf);
+       log(ERROR, "%s: %s", msg, strerror_r(errno, errbuf, sizeof(errbuf)));
 }